    Early Life and Background

    Born Sean John Combs on November 4, 1969, in Harlem, New York City, Diddy's early life laid the foundation for his future success. Growing up in a challenging environment, he faced numerous obstacles but managed to rise above them through determination and talent. His mother, Janice Combs, was a model and teacher, while his father, Melvin Earl Combs, was a convicted drug dealer who tragically passed away when Sean was just 3 years old.

    Is Diddy Jewish? Exploring His Religious Background

    To answer the question, "Is Diddy Jewish?" we must first understand his family's religious affiliations. Diddy was raised in a Christian household, specifically within the Pentecostal faith. His mother, Janice Combs, was a devout Christian, and this upbringing played a significant role in shaping his early years. There is no evidence to suggest that Diddy or his immediate family have Jewish roots.

    Understanding Jewish Heritage

    What Defines Jewish Identity?

    Jewish identity is defined by a combination of religious beliefs, cultural traditions, and ethnic heritage. Judaism is not only a religion but also an ethnicity, with a rich history spanning thousands of years. For someone to be considered Jewish, they typically have Jewish parents or have converted to Judaism through a recognized process.
